Default 1995 Mustang GT LED Brake Light, 2 LEDs stating on

hello all!
I recently installed a new third brake light on my 1995 mustang GT. it is an LED strip and looks great! one problem is, the last two LED's on the right side never turn off when the key is turned to on. When the car is off the lights turn off just fine, but when the key is in the on position, only the last two LED bulbs are lit up. When the brake lights are pressed, all LED's turn on like they're supposed to. I've tried everything I can think of. I even tried pulling all of the fuses to see where the power was coming from. Only one fuse affected the light and even then they only dimmed, but didn't turn off. I am completely out of ideas as to why they will not turn off. Also, my tail lights, which also have new LED bulbs, have the same problem. While they stay on whenever the key is on, they are VERY dim. When the third brake light is unplugged, the tail lights get stronger. The tail lights go out when a fuse is pulled, but the 3rd brake light stay shining. I really don't know what else to do and would really like to keep my LED's. so if anyone has any suggestions, it would be GREATLY appreciated! Thank you!

Sounds like a weak or missing ground. Try to find the wire(s) coming from the taillight harness, which are fastened to the body by a screw. Maybe pull the screw, and clean the contact surfaces, and reattach.
Do the tails stay on when the third brakelight is unplugged?
